Haversian Canals
Microscopic tubes in bone that contain blood vessels and nerves.
Perforating Canals
Perforating canals, also known as Volkmann's canals, are channels within compact bone that allow blood vessels, lymph vessels, and nerves to travel across bone, connecting with Haversian canals.
